NEW MOON IN SAGITTARIUS – THURSDAY 27 TH NOVEMBER @ 16.55
This is the moon of thanksgiving and comes at the perfect time. It’s easy to get caught up in the drama of life and feel the victim of circumstance - powerless against an unknown force.
Focusing on gratitude for the wonderful things we have helps shift the focus away from feeling a victim of life. Instead, recognise the things you may be taking for granted to shift any negative, hopeless feelings. The sun is always shining even when we cannot see it and sometimes we have to change our perspective to recognise all the wonderful things in our lives. Sagittarius reminds us to count our blessings and dance in the rain. We create our own reality, and when we take personal responsibility for our lives, our ability to live fully and joyfully increases.
This moon’s message to ‘be the change’ through our actions towards ourselves, others and Mother Earth asks us: ‘How can I best show my appreciation for everything I have in my life, even the challenges I fear, and really enjoy what is happening right now?’
Sagittarius is ruled by Jupiter, the planet of abundance and inner growth. We are encouraged to expand our minds and increase our knowledge so this is a good time to do something new. Interests, hobbies and talents that may have been suppressed or forgotten may re-emerge now, so be alert to things that catch your interest. Doors may open at this time to learn something new, join a symposium or take a class in something that fascinates you. Be courageous and follow your passion.
